Master's Transmission Obscuration Static

The Master's Transmission Obscuration Static is an auditory disruption tool, a specialized form of electronic interference that the Master deploys to manipulate and sever communications. Unlike his visual surveillance tactics, this static weaponizes white noise—harsh bursts of digital distortion that swallow voices mid-syllable and render transmissions into impenetrable hiss. It first appears as a general countermeasure against hails, then in a specific incident where Lester's attempts to contact an approaching craft degrade into static, frustrating Stevenson at the console and disabling the beacon's alert systems. Later, during Huckle's final transmission into the void, the static evolves into something more terrifying: a living force that swells with cruel precision, drowning the third rig's distress call before the operator's panicked pleas can form. With each use, the static confirms itself as a signature technique of the Master—a deliberate, lethal seal on his victims' fates, leaving only electronic screech where voices once implored.

Purpose

To disrupt, manipulate, and control communications by creating an artificial barrier that both hides the Master's voice alteration and overwhelms the Doctor's distress signal.

Significance

Serves as a tactical layer in the Master's misdirection, turning a routine comms channel into an instrument of chaos. This static doesn't just obscure sound—it embodies his method of seizing authority through deception, escalating the confrontation from a diplomatic plea to a full-blown existential threat.
